Art criticism process: 1)Describe what you see 2)Analyze using art terms 3)Interpret 4)Evaluate My critique: I see a jewelry tray with a monogram in the center. I started with a tray mold and put clay on top of the tray to get the perfect fit. I cut the outside of the tray to make a smooth outline for the tray. Water was my key component to making the tray smooth. Once the tray was smooth I put it in the kiln. The tray cooled down after a few days and then I engraved my initials with a pencil and then put the glaze on top and then back in the kiln. The monogram is used as the focal point of the piece which draws your eye to the center.. I used a shiny paint for the polka dots and a basic acrylic for the monogram. Overall I believe I could have taken a little more time on the polka dots because once they went in the kiln the polka dots blended together. The sides of the tray could be a lot smoother. The most difficult part about this was the roses because it was hard to make them light enough so the top doesn't sink. 3.The base is one of my favorite parts because it's very smooth and round. 4. I started out with a flattened piece of clay and i rounded it around a pole and made the base. I scored and slipped a bunch of small balls and handles on to the base. I made the top and scored and slipped roses onto the top and then fired it in the kiln. Questions:
